Explain why core of a transformer is always laminated.

एक पंक्ति में उत्तर
Advertisements

उत्तर

The core of a transformer is always laminated to reduce the loss of power/energy due to eddy currents.

Long distance power transmissions

The large-scale transmission and distribution of electrical energy over long distances is done with the use of transformers. The voltage output of the generator is stepped up. It is then transmitted over long distances to an area sub-station near the consumers. There the voltage is stepped down. It is further stepped down at distributing sub-stations and utility poles before a power supply of 240 V reaches our homes.
